An Advanced Certificate in Risk Management for Precision Engineers equips participants with the crucial skills to identify, assess, and mitigate risks inherent in precision engineering projects. This specialized program emphasizes practical application, ensuring graduates are prepared to navigate complex challenges within the industry.
Learning outcomes include a comprehensive understanding of risk assessment methodologies specific to precision engineering, proficiency in risk management tools and techniques, and the ability to develop and implement effective risk mitigation strategies. Participants will also gain expertise in regulatory compliance and best practices within the field, enhancing their professional capabilities.
The program's duration typically ranges from six to twelve months, depending on the institution and mode of delivery (online or in-person). The flexible learning options cater to working professionals seeking to upskill or transition within the precision engineering sector.
This Advanced Certificate in Risk Management for Precision Engineers holds significant industry relevance. Graduates are highly sought after by manufacturing companies, aerospace firms, and other organizations operating within the precision engineering domain. The certification demonstrates a commitment to safety, quality, and operational excellence, making graduates highly competitive in the job market. This advanced training covers topics such as quality control, safety regulations, and project management, making it highly valuable for career advancement.
The program's focus on practical application and industry-specific knowledge ensures that graduates possess the necessary skills to effectively manage risks throughout the entire product lifecycle, contributing to enhanced productivity and profitability for their employers. This directly addresses the critical needs of manufacturing and engineering businesses dealing with complex precision machinery and processes.

Why this course?
An Advanced Certificate in Risk Management is increasingly significant for precision engineers in the UK's competitive market. The UK's manufacturing sector, heavily reliant on precision engineering, faces evolving challenges. According to a recent study by the Institution of Mechanical Engineers, nearly 60% of UK manufacturers cite supply chain disruptions as a major concern, highlighting the critical need for robust risk management strategies. Furthermore, a growing emphasis on sustainability and ethical sourcing adds another layer of complexity.
This certificate equips precision engineers with the skills to proactively identify, assess, and mitigate risks across the product lifecycle. From design and manufacturing to supply chain management and product liability, mastering risk management principles is paramount. Effective risk management leads to improved efficiency, reduced costs, and enhanced project success rates, boosting a precision engineer's career prospects in a highly demanding field.
